Why Buy a Spare Car Key?

You could end up spending time and money if lose your car keys. Modern keys are more difficult to replace since they are equipped with transponder chips that have to be connected to a vehicle's computer.

Convenience

It's no secret that getting locked out of your car can be a major hassle. It can be more difficult to not have a spare car key. This is especially true if you're stuck in a foreign area. A spare key will save you time and money. A spare key can aid you in avoiding costly repairs or replacements.

A spare key is useful if you share your vehicle with another. This can save you from having to call a locksmith to cut another key if you lose yours. You can offer the spare key to someone else in case they require it. This is useful if you are lending your car to family or friends.

A spare key can also aid in reducing wear and tear on your car keys. It's normal for keys to get worn down over time, particularly when you use them frequently. However, if you have a spare key you can switch between them to preserve the original. You can also reduce the damage to your keys by rotating them each month.

It might not be to be as important as the cost savings but having a spare key in your possession can be very useful in the long term. You don't want to be stranded in the middle of winter on a cold, chilly morning without a way to get back home. If you have an extra car key you can rest assured that you won't ever be in this situation again.

In addition to the convenience having a spare key can also improve the value of your vehicle when it's time to sell or trade it in. If you have two of the same key, the dealership will usually offer you an increased selling or trade-in value than if you only have one.
